He is a writer specialized in technology, business, and culture, topics he knows deeply and has used to write his popular science books.
He worked as an editor at the Harward Business Review, regularly collaborates with the Financial Times, The Guardian, and Strategy & Business, and has also contributed as a columnist occasionally in various publications like the New York Times, Wired, The Atlantic, and Business 2.0. He also serves as a speaker at MIT, Harvard, Wharton, and NASA, among other institutions and companies. He is a member of the editorial committee of the Encyclopaedia Britannica.
Nicholas Carr was selected in 2005 by Optimize magazine as one of the most influential experts on issues related to information technology, and was also chosen in 2007 by eWeek among the 100 most influential people in this field.
